Joe Rainey has announced a North American tour. The tour dates are in support of his recent debut album, Niineta, which was released earlier this year on Justin Vernon and the Dessner brothers’ 37d03d label. The Minneapolis-based pow wow singer will perform in venues across the United States and Canada, kicking off the tour in Milwaukee before performing at festivals including Pop Montreal, Iowa City’s Feast Festival, and more. Joe Rainey’s debut album was released in May, following collaborations with Chance the Rapper, Bon Iver, and Low, among others. The album was produced by Andrew Broder of Fog.
